Veteran composer and Carnatic music exponent Venkateswara Dakshinamurthy,’Swamy’ for the industry and fans,passed away in Chennai on Friday. He was 93 and is survived by his wife Kalyani. After numerous stage performances in Kerala,where he was born and brought up,Dakshinamurthy came to Chennai in 1942 to sing for the AIR. He began composing music for films in 1948,with the film Nalla Thanka. He directed the music for 125 films in Tamil and predominantly in Malayalam,the latest for Mizhikal Sakshi four years ago when he was 90.
